Gilbert Collard
Summary
Gilbert Collard is a human[1]. He was born in Marseille[2]. He was born on February 3, 1948[3]. He worked as a politician[4], lawyer[5], and writer[6]. He ranks in the top 0.73% of human entities by monthly Wikipedia readership (31 views/month, #7,284 of 1,000,298).[7]
